On the fence? Read on! (Updated: Oct2022)
The tagline for the 10th gen Fire 7 is “Tiny price, big fun” and I gotta admit, whoever came up with that, nailed it. It is tiny but it works great. Here is the thing, know what to expect and you won’t be disappointed. Positives: -The new Fire OS is a significant improvement. It is closer to current android, and it is intuitive-ish if you have used an Android phone before. - The processing power and the responsiveness improvement is significant when compared to the previous gen. The promotional material states that it is 30% faster and after trying it, I agree. - Live view on another Amazon device, using specific skills like Ring or WYZE, using Alexa, in general having this as a portable automation control at your fingertips, works very well. - Still has a headphone jack. - Supports up to 1TB microSD card. Running it with 256GB just fine. - Made with environmentally conscious materials. - Voice control is as good as with any other Amazon device. - Still works great for reading your E-books and browsing the web. This review was written in it, btw. Negatives: - A lot of the same negatives of the previous Gen. Screen Resolution? Still 1024X600. Memory? Still 16GB, maybe 32GB if you cough up another 20$, which I did. - No fast charge means that given that the battery is larger than the previous model, the charge time is also longer. Other thoughts: I intend to use this tablet as my portable hub for my amazon devices; so far it works great for that. I did a bit of streaming and internet browsing and it works great for that too, albeit the resolution could definitely better, which I knew coming in. It is significantly faster than its predecessor. Given that I like the previous one, I am pleased. Don’t get me wrong, I would prefer to have a better resolution or more memory on the starting model or maybe even better speakers (plural), but Amazon improved the model significantly in another area (performance) without significantly affecting the price. Thus, while it is not perfect, I give it five stars. Recommended! Update: I see some people complain about battery life, I haven’t experienced this. Battery life has been better than the previous Fire, not by a bunch but noticeable. TLDR; The new fire 7 is FIRE. Worth every penny.
